The campaign for the 2028 presidential elections has begun.
The arena for the first round of the battle is the impeachment trial of Vice President Sara Duterte which is scheduled to start on July 30.
Public attention is now on the 24 senators of the 20th Congress who will sit as judges in the impeachment trial including the 12 who won in the May 12 midterm elections.
Making life worth living.